What Car?’s overall 2018 Car of the Year, the new Volvo XC40 premium compact SUV, is now available for test drives at M. R. King & Sons in Halesworth, Suffolk. The car, which was launched by M. R. King & Sons on 22 February, breaks new ground for Volvo as its first ever compact SUV. Every XC40 is exceptionally well equipped. Even the entry-level Momentum version has a nine-inch touch screen control system, satellite navigation, LED headlights, dual-zone climate control with a sophisticated interior air-quality system, and 18-inch alloy wheels – all as standard. The XC40 comes with lots of exciting technology, too. This includes the Volvo On Call app, which allows you to control various car functions from your smartphone or smartwatch, while the Sensus nine-inch touch screen works in tandem with the sophisticated voice-activated control system.

Three petrol engines – the 156 hp T3, 190 hp T4 and 247 hp T5 – are available, along with two diesels – the 150 hp D3 and 190 hp D4. Front-wheel drive, all-wheel drive and a choice of six-speed manual or eight-speed automatic gearboxes allows you to choose the precise car to suit your individual needs.

The What Car? judges said: “The XC40 mixes style, space and comfort with cutting-edge safety and relative affordability so ably that we named it our 2018 What Car? Car of the Year. Amid a year of great cars, it stands out as the most impressive by far.”
